This phrasebook contains a guide to Spanish pronunciation and grammar, sample phrases and sentences arranged by topic, and a dictionary of 850 of the most commonly used words and phrases. It focuses on the dialect spoken in Cuba.The Spanish spoken in Cuba differs from that spoken in other countries in the Caribbean and South America in several ways. While it still shares the spelling of the words with other dialects, you will see some pronunciations which are distinctive particularly in the softening of consonants and some letters are silent or dropped. Since Spanish is primarily a phonetic language we are beginning to see some althernate accepted spellings emerge.
